Happy One Year,
Ruby Beach!

Thanks to the Downtown Investment Authority’s Food and Beverage Retail Enhancement Program aimed at attracting new retail to Downtown, Ruby Beach Brewing moved inland from its beaches location to #DTJax last year and has been serving the Downtown community libations ever since.

Activating Jacksonville’s Riverfront

The Jessie Ball duPont Fund is helping to convene a series of conversations about how best to activate our city’s downtown waterfront for the benefit of all of our residents and visitors. Visit their page to learn more.

1st Downtown Jacksonville: The Future of the Shipyards 

1st DownTown Jacksonville is a platform created to help communicate, advocate and unite supporters who share the same passion for Downtown. Check out their website to learn about plans for The Shipyards, a path toward the Stadium of the Future and community investment by the Jaguars and Iguana Investments.
